About this work

Ole Kandelin painted a dark figure in a dim room. The person sits with their back to us, lit only by a single light source. The cardboard support gives the surface a rough, uneven look. Kandelin used oil paint thickly here. This technique is called impasto. It makes the light catch certain spots and leaves others shadowed. You can almost feel the texture if you look close.
